What do I enjoy most about tutoring? 😁
I genuinely enjoy seeing the smile on a student’s face when they finally grasp a concept. Having gone through tutoring myself growing up, I understand how relieving it feels to have doubts cleared and that weight lifted. My family owns a tutoring company, and over the years, I’ve had the opportunity to help students who felt overwhelmed and left behind. Being able to support them through that process—and witnessing the moment everything clicks—is incredibly rewarding. It’s that moment of clarity and confidence that makes it all worthwhile.
My Strengths as Tutor 💪
One of my key strengths as a tutor is the experience I’ve gained not only from tutoring myself but also from observing my mother and brother in their roles as tutors. This exposure has helped me develop a range of strategies to support students with diverse learning needs. For instance, I’ve found that encouraging students with ADHD to walk around while reciting concepts can significantly improve their focus and retention.

Most important things I can do for a student 🏅
I believe the most important qualities of an effective tutor are:
Approachability – It’s essential that students feel comfortable enough to ask questions without fear of judgment. Creating a safe and welcoming environment is the first step to meaningful learning.
Creativity and adaptability – Every student learns differently, so it’s important to be flexible and think of engaging, innovative ways to explain concepts. This helps maintain their interest and focus, even with more challenging material.

About Raksha
Proven Mathematics and Programming Tutor
Raksha brings hands-on experience tutoring high school students in mathematics, as well as guiding learners in programming. She has delivered private lessons to both secondary and university students, adapting her approach to suit each individual''s needs. Her success is underlined by her recognition as a top 12 finalist in a Mathematics Olympiad competition, which demonstrates not only subject mastery but also the ability to inspire confidence and problem-solving skills in her students.
Engaging Communicator with Public Speaking Expertise
With eight years of debate and public speaking experience, Raksha excels at breaking down complex concepts into understandable steps. As a finalist in national-level public speaking competitions and a junior judge for debate events, she brings exceptional communication skills that help students feel comfortable asking questions and participating actively. These experiences allow her to foster an encouraging learning environment where curiosity is welcomed.
Leadership Through Real-World Projects
Raksha’s leadership shines through her involvement in STEM competitions—she has programmed robots for international challenges, mentored student teams for engineering contests, and led groups through project-based learning. Notably, she designed educational solutions such as an AI-powered water quality tracker that won international recognition. Her dynamic background enables her to relate classroom learning to real-world applications, motivating students by connecting maths and English skills to exciting practical projects.
